My preferred method is … WebMar 17, 2024 · The INDEX function can handle arrays natively, so the second INDEX is added only to "catch" the array created with the boolean logic operation and return the same array again to MATCH. To do this, INDEX is configured with zero rows and one column. The zero row trick causes INDEX to return column 1 from the array (which is already one …

WebThis makes it a unique Id. Next, the VLOOKUP formula takes this as lookup value and looks for its location in table A3:N10. Here , VLOOKUP finds the value in 6th row of the table. Now it moves to the 3rd column and returns the value. This is the easiest way to get the Nth match in Excel. But it is not feasible all the time.

WebSummary. To get the nth MATCH with VLOOKUP, you'll need to add a helper column to your table that constructs a unique id that includes the count.
